Back for a new season, with “sailing fan” Granville now woken from his Olympic dream, we return for another podcast after a three-month hiatus.

While some of the regulars are shelved this week, we talk over the Sky Sports Game, welcome new Fantasy Football double act “Fenners & Merse” and start the clear up after Robin Van Persie kicked over the applecart.

The episode is underpinned by a new concept – the idea that Granville and I can join forces and actually be effective. The premise is we pick a ScoutCast XI and cross our beams to co-manage it over the season, arguing the toss in every ScoutCast episode on transfers and substitutions. The aim is harmony and a united success. It seems unlikely to end that way.

Oh, and there are actually two of my “jokes” that Granville misses in this episode – see if you can make out the second. I swear he was dreaming of gold medals in the sailing.

      I will be honest, in the last 3 years whenever I have been a part of the pre-season here, you end up with a somewhat generic team. It just happens whether you want it to or not. Now the thing is that you get around 10 players who do as well as you predicted, maybe 2/3 of these 10 even exceed expectations. The place where we often go wrong on is picking the right emerging player using your free transfer each week, and getting rid of the Moses of your team. That's what gonna be really crucial down the line. Try to snap the right player and things will turn out just fine.
